Cluster analysis or clustering is the task of grouping a set of objects in such a way that
objects in the same group called a cluster are more similar in some sense to each other
than to those in other groups clusters It is a main task of exploratory data analysis,
and a common technique for statistical data analysis, used in many fields, including pattern
recognition, image analysis, information retrieval, bioinformatics, data compression,
computer graphics and machine learning. It is typically done based on similarity and
differences. Other aspects of continuity are also considered here.

The principles of grouping or Gestalt laws of grouping are a set of principles in
psychology, first proposed by Gestalt psychologists to account for the observation that
humans naturally perceive objects as organized patterns and objects, a principle known as
Prgnanz Gestalt psychologists argued that these principles exist because the mind has an
innate disposition to perceive patterns in the stimulus based on certain rules. These
principles are organized into five categories: Proximity, Similarity, Continuity, Closure,
and Connectedness.
